Key trends driving demand: Keyboard-first workflows -- rising preference for keyboard-driven productivity among developers and knowledge workers increases demand for fast, scriptable shortcuts; Micro‑SaaS consumerization -- users now buy small, focused paid utilities that solve one pain point well; Automation & macros -- growing use of automation tools (Shortcuts, Raycast, Alfred) creates an ecosystem receptive to interoperable utilities.
Key competitors include BetterTouchTool (folivora.ai), Hammerspoon, Alfred (Powerpack), Keyboard Maestro, Apptivate.
